a veces el decifrado falla porque el valor todavía no estaba cifrado

buscamos un espacio para saber si se trata de una oración o un mensaje
que realmente no se pudo decifrar.

fixes #1704
fixes #1706
fixes #1708
fixes #1709
fixes #1710
fixes #1712
fixes #1713
fixes #1714
fixes #1717
fixes #1718
fixes #1719
fixes #1721
fixes #1723
fixes #1724
fixes #1725
fixes #1728
fixes #1779
fixes #1780
fixes #1785
fixes #1799
fixes #1800
fixes #1802
fixes #1803
fixes #1804
fixes #1805
fixes #1807
fixes #1809
fixes #1810
fixes #1811
fixes #1813
This commit is contained in:
f 2021-05-24 10:49:35 -03:00
parent 691f064a24
commit 160558470b

View file

@ -211,10 +211,14 @@ MetadataTemplate = Struct.new(:site, :document, :name, :label, :type,
box.decrypt_str value.to_s box.decrypt_str value.to_s
rescue Lockbox::DecryptionError => e rescue Lockbox::DecryptionError => e
if value.to_s.include? ' '
value
else
ExceptionNotifier.notify_exception(e, data: { site: site.name, post: post.path.absolute, name: name }) ExceptionNotifier.notify_exception(e, data: { site: site.name, post: post.path.absolute, name: name })
I18n.t('lockbox.help.decryption_error') I18n.t('lockbox.help.decryption_error')
end end
end
# Cifra el valor. # Cifra el valor.
# #